Ordinals
alpha
Address 1BPSJofqkohWNPMktjpJNF2qxK7sQq77yL
sat balance
2984792
runes balances
outputs
3bf2ee0978edc4301e8ecaf3f8daa94d57202e039928a978f9c45d51592df97b:1